Recognizing the signs of gallbladder problems is crucial for timely diagnosis and treatment. Persistent digestive issues, sharp abdominal pain, jaundice, changes in bowel and urine color, and chronic fatigue with nausea are significant indicators. If you experience any of these symptoms, consulting with a healthcare provider is essential to address the underlying issue and prevent further complications.
